Transaction af962132c31d4021590f551f50b285469956ae146eaa42497253e94f0b3aadd0

1 Input
2 Outputs
  • af962132c31d4021590f551f50b285469956ae146eaa42497253e94f0b3aadd0:0
  • value  139106
    address  3Cg44h4TvVPCzjorHmDV5A4AK5K77r1Dmv
  • af962132c31d4021590f551f50b285469956ae146eaa42497253e94f0b3aadd0:1
  • value  2315741
    address  156SdWfy68tWr6EWosq8qSZRq3fLNGozzk